So, imagine this: the Bénin national women’s U20 team, affectionately known as the Amazones, ventured into Côte d’Ivoire this past Saturday and really put on a show! They managed to snatch a 1-1 draw against the home side, the Éléphantes, giving them a seriously strong position heading into the second leg of this qualifier.

all eyes on the home leg in Bénin
Now, it all comes down to the home game! With this draw, the Amazones U20 are in a fantastic position. All they need is a goalless draw (0-0) or, even better, a win in the return match, and Bénin will be heading straight to the next round. How exciting is that?
“The girls truly showed their heart,” shared someone close to the technical staff. “Coming back from behind in Abidjan is no small feat. Now, we just need to keep our focus sharp and finish the job right here in front of our home crowd.”
